How does the infant-to-toddler convertibility work on these rockers, and what should I look for to ensure lasting use?
Convertibility means the seat adapts as your child grows, letting you use the same rocker from infancy through toddlerhood. Look for adjustable harnesses, multiple reclining levels, and seat height options that accommodate a growing child. Check the weight capacity and whether trays or toy arches detach for easier transitions and extended use with the infant to toddler design.

What maintenance and safety checks should I perform for an infant to toddler rocker?
Regular safety checks and cleaning keep an infant to toddler rocker safe. Wipe surfaces with mild soap and water, wash removable covers, and inspect harnesses, buckles, and screws for wear. Ensure the base remains stable, and verify the product still fits through doorways and around furniture as your child grows.
